Bradley Macdonald posted a new career-high in runs on Tuesday. He got on base in all three of his plate appearances with three stolen bases and three runs. He was dominant the last time he took on Samuell on Tuesday, so they probably should've seen this coming. Macdonald is becoming a predictor of Wilson's success: when he posts at least two runs the team is undefeated (and 4-5-1 when he doesn't).
Macdonald's strong effort led Wilson over Samuell and he'll get a chance to do so again: the teams have a rematch scheduled at 4:30 p.m. on Thursday. The Spartans are limping into the matchup having lost eight straight at home dating back to last season.
